Christopher Pugliese, the owner of Tompkins Square Bagels at 165 Avenue A near East 10th Street, confirmed to us last night that he has a deal in place for a second location at 184 Second Ave.
He will be taking over the space that previously housed Open Pantry, the 45-year-old coffee shop/grocery between East 11th Street and East 12th Street that closed for good at the end of January.
The proprietors of Open Pantry also own the building.
"They specifically made it a point not to bring in a big corporate business," Pugliese told us via email. "They wanted to keep it local."
We'll have more details later about the timing of the opening of the second TSB shop. (Tompkins Square Bagels opened on Avenue A near East 10th Street in December 2011.)
"It's a go," he said. "I am very excited."
